Is the 2021 Kandi K27 good on gas?

At up to 114 MPG combined, the 2021 Kandi K27 is better than average for a Compact Cars — that class averages about 24.1 MPG across 6,481 EPA-tested versions, so it's a good pick on fuel for its size.

Real-world MPG vs the EPA number

The EPA figures above come from a standardized dynamometer test, not the open road — real-world MPG typically runs a bit lower depending on your driving, climate and terrain. That's true of every car on this site, old or new.

For its most efficient trim, the EPA estimates about $650 a year in fuel (15,000 miles) — roughly $54 a month.
